Set us as preferred Nearly a week after being rescued near Big Bear Lake, Jackie — half of a celebrity bald eagle couple — remains in critical condition as veterinarians continue to puzzle over the cause of her maladies.Back at the nest, Shadow is caring for their eaglets but may be spending time with a younger female.Suffering from severe anemia and kidney inflammation, Jackie received a life-saving blood transfusion but is still in intensive care.
The blood was provided by Spirit, an eagle living at a Bakersfield zoo, according to the Ojai Raptor Center, where she’s receiving treatment.Announced in an Instagram post Thursday, the center said the 14-year-old eagle’s kidney inflammation has improved.
But experts are still trying to understand the cause of her anemia.They’ve ruled out lead toxicity and the presence of objects like fishing hooks and weights.
Photos accompanying the post show staff tending to the eagle, who appears massive on a medical table.“The eagle continues to perch and eat, and there is slight improvement in her energy,” says the center’s Eliza Cameron in the post.“Her condition remains critical at this time, and this is not a straightforward case.” Climate & Environment Rescued Big Bear eagle Jackie has anemia and kidney inflammation, and remains in critical condition.
